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3125814518 92 3329830985
4931687573 2520497
4931687573 2520497
269 54977081 06591799 08
All about undefined
Interested in learning more?
4931687573 2520497
269 54977081 06591799 08
See more
3040081631 846049
43041 3652872 1230753
See more
277 12 2899311
0197216315 86006 04
See more